French, 1914 - 1955de Stael was born into an aristocratic family in St Petersburg, Russia . After the revolution the family fled to Poland and Nicolas was sent to Brussels to study art. After years of travelling in Europe and Africa he eventually settled in Paris in 1938. During the war he fought in the French Foreign Legion, returning to Paris to become a painter and a leading exponent of the School of Paris painters. He also had a small but important output of prints. |
